Moldable ferromagnetic particles and method
Patent Abstract
Moldable ferromagnetic particles and method of making a magnetizable molding
therefrom. The ferromagnetic particles are spray-coated with a slurry comprising
insoluble thermoplastic particles suspended in a solution of a soluble polymer
to produce a coating on the ferromagnetic particles which comprises a majority
of the insoluble thermoplastic particles embedded in a lesser amount of a
binder polymer. When compression molded, the insoluble thermoplastic particles
form a continuous matrix for the ferromagnetic particles.
